ELSA, Texas (ValleyCentral) — An IDEA student was taken into custody for allegedly sending a school threat through text message, authorities say.

At approximately 9:15 p.m. on Saturday, April 5, the Elsa Police Department received a report regarding a school threat directed toward IDEA Public School in Elsa.

According to a news release from Elsa PD, the text message received by a minor said, "Shoot up the school."

The minor who received the text message quickly informed their parents, who contacted the authorities regarding the threat.

Elsa PD investigators later discovered the suspect who sent the message was a 13-year-old IDEA student, the release added. The suspect was taken into custody and booked at the Hidalgo County Juvenile Detention Center.

The minor was charged with a terroristic threat causing fear of imminent serious bodily injury, a class A misdemeanor.
